Understanding The Playthrough And Bet Limits
The fine print here is one to watch. The bonus funds come with a 40x wagering requirement, so if you nab the full NZD 2,500 bonus, you’re looking at hitting NZD 100,000 in wagering before cashing out bonus-related winnings. That might sound like climbing Everest, but putting it into perspective, it boils down to a realistic target for players who enjoy longer sessions and don’t chase quick cashouts.
However, there’s a catch for those who thrive on big spins. The maximum bet while wagering the bonus is capped at NZD 5 per spin or game round. This forces a level of restraint for true whales—those who might prefer drops or spins in the NZD 25-50+ range—because betting bigger can void your bonus progress.
| Bonus Aspect | Details |
|---|---|
| Wagering Requirement | 40x Bonus Amount |
| Max Bet During Wagering | NZD 5 Per Spin/Round |
| Bonus Max Cashout | NZD 5,000 |
| Cashback | 10% on Net Losses, Wager-Free, Max NZD 1,000 |
| Bonus Validity | 7 Days |
